PNG Corporation designs and builds roller coasters for amusement parks. At the end of 20x1, managers estimated overhead costs for 20x2 of $150,000 based on expected production of 5 roller coasters using 5,000 labour hours each. Actual overhead costs for 20x2 were $170,000. PNG actually designed and built 6 roller coasters with the following direct labour usage and overhead costs:

Assume PNG uses a normal costing system with the number of labor hours as the overhead allocation base.

a) How much overhead would be allocated to each job?
b) Calculate the total over- or underapplied overhead (specify which) for each job.

The Big Dipper The Ultimate Scream Loop Me The Screaming Chicken You Don't Know Coasters Old Faithful Overhead Cost $28,000 35,000 27,000 40,000 25,000 15,000 Labour Hours 3,500 4,000 5,000 2,500 6,000 4,500

Explanation / Answer

a.

Calculate the predetermined overhead rate as follows:

Predetermined overhead rate

= Estimated overhead cost/Estimated labor hours

= $150,000/(5 x 5,000)

= $6 per direct labor hour

Calculate the amount of overhead cost allocated to each job by multiplying the predetermined overhead rate by the number of direct labor hours used by each job.

Overhead cost allocated to The Big Dipper = $6 x 3,500 = $21,000

Overhead cost allocated to The Ultimate Scream = $6 x 4,000 = $24,000

Overhead cost allocated to Loop Me = $6 x 5,000 = $30,000

Overhead cost allocated to The Screaming Chicken = $6 x 2,500 = $15,000

Overhead cost allocated to You Don't Know Coasters = $6 x 6,000 = $36,000

Overhead cost allocated to Old Faithful = $6 x 4,500 = $27,000

b.

Calculate the over- or underapplied overhead as follows:

Total overhead cost allocated to all jobs

= $21,000 + $24,000 + $30,000 + $15,000 + $36,000 + $27,000

= $153,000

Actual overhead cost incurred

= $28,000 + $35,000 + $27,000 + $40,000 + $25,000 + $15,000

= $170,000

Since actual overhead cost is greater than the amount of overhead cost allocated to all jobs, overhead is underapplied.

Underapplied overhead = $170,000 - $153,000 = $17,000
